Pos Pos severs ties with longtime vendor

Distributor blames conflicting business models as reason for the break-up

Retail equipment distributor, Pos Pos, has severed ties with longtime vendor, Wincor Nixdorf.

Pos Pos had been distributing for the German-based retail and banking sector centric vendor for five years.

Conflict with Wincor Nixdorf’s business model was pinned as the reason for the two parting ways.

“[I]n addition to hardware, Wincor Nixdorf’s business model requires a significant focus on full solutions that include software and services, which are not core to the traditional distribution model,” Pos Pos CEO, Daniel Danielli, said in a statement. “We have, therefore, come to an amicable decision to no longer represent them as a vendor.”

As a result, Pos Pos sales and marketing director, Vik Devjee, who initiated the partnership has left the distributor to represent the vendor’ in Australia through a new company. He will take over to service existing Wincor Nixdorf resellers and customers.

Grant Cleland, who established the distributor’s NSW business, will take over from Devjee as head of sales and marketing for Pos Pos.
